Charm Industrial, a pioneering leader in carbon removal technology, has successfully raised $100 million in its latest funding round, furthering its mission to restore atmospheric COâ‚‚ levels to a pre-industrial benchmark of 280 ppm. Founded on breakthrough innovations by Chief Scientist and co-founder Shaun Meehan in 2020, the company has developed a fleet of mobile pyrolyzers designed to convert agricultural and forestry biomass residues into bio-oil. This bio-oil serves a dual purpose: it contributes to carbon removal initiatives and is also utilized in direct-reduced-iron steelmaking, promoting a more sustainable industrial process. Since its inception, Charm Industrial has made remarkable strides in the realm of carbon neutrality. Within just ten months of its first carbon removal injection, the company successfully removed more than 5,000 tons of COâ‚‚e in 2021 for a variety of notable clients, including prominent corporations like Stripe, Shopify, and Microsoft.
